Long story from Mr Inglethorpe's days, it has been on the Big Bank for around 4 years now it was intended to help grow the amount of singers on the Big Bank, it is situated where the singers gather and the intention was the more singers the bigger the heart will grow etc. Never really caught on due to a lack of explanation / promotion from the club at the time! The Heart has now become iconic and tends to be a talking point of those people who visit the club and after a long discussion it was decided not to let it fade away.
